To me the CTR stocks with no tube and buffer should not be more than $60. Don't get me wrong, they are great stocks that fit tight and offer a better cheek weld than a traditional M4 stock, but they are not really anything special. They have no compartments, and unless you pay extra, they also do not have any sling swivels, nor a buttpad.

At the end of the day, a traditional M4 butt stock will get the job done just as well as a CTR.
